Nollaig Crombie is a multidisciplinary artist with extensive experience in both the academic and industrial sectors. On graduating from the National College of Art & Design, she was invited to join Sullivan Bluth Animation in Los Angeles. She worked on nine of their feature films before accepting a lecturing position in Art & Design in Letterkenny in 1992. Her international freelance artwork continued alongside teaching until taking up the role of Head of Design & Cerative Media at (LYIT) ATU in 2005. Since Nollaig retired from ATU just over a year ago, her passion for teaching and art practice remains her focus.
